How do you spawn the Headless Horseman in Terraria?

Taming Terror: A Comprehensive Guide to Spawning the Headless Horseman in Terraria

The Headless Horseman in Terraria isn’t your average, everyday enemy. This spooky foe is a formidable challenge reserved for those who’ve progressed deep into Hardmode. You don’t actually spawn the Headless Horseman directly through any specific item or summoning ritual in the traditional sense. Instead, he appears during the Pumpkin Moon event. To encounter him, you need to trigger the Pumpkin Moon and survive long enough for him to spawn. Specifically, the Headless Horseman starts appearing from Wave 5 onwards during the Pumpkin Moon event. Therefore, your goal is to initiate the Pumpkin Moon event.

How to Summon the Pumpkin Moon: The Key to Meeting the Headless Horseman

Here’s the breakdown of how to trigger the Pumpkin Moon, the event during which the Headless Horseman appears:

  1. Defeat Plantera: This is the primary prerequisite. The Pumpkin Moon is a post-Plantera Hardmode event, so make sure you’ve taken down this Jungle boss first.

  2. Craft the Pumpkin Moon Medallion: This is the item used to summon the event. The recipe requires:

    • 30 Pumpkins: Easily obtainable by growing them from Pumpkin Seeds (sold by the Dryad during Halloween or after Plantera is defeated) on grass.
    • 5 Ectoplasm: Dropped by Dungeon Spirits (found in the Dungeon after Plantera is defeated).
    • 10 Hallowed Bars: Obtained from defeating mechanical bosses.

    Combine these ingredients at a Mythril Anvil or Orichalcum Anvil.

  3. Use the Medallion at Night: The Pumpkin Moon can only be summoned at night. Using the Pumpkin Moon Medallion at any point between 7:30 PM and 4:30 AM will start the event.

  4. Survive the Waves: The Headless Horseman starts spawning from Wave 5 onwards. The higher the wave, the more frequently he’ll appear. Prepare for a relentless onslaught of Halloween-themed enemies!

Preparing for the Pumpkin Moon and the Headless Horseman

Before diving headfirst into the Pumpkin Moon, preparation is vital. Here’s a checklist:

  • Gear Up: Use the best armor and weapons you have available. Post-Plantera gear such as Turtle Armor or Beetle Armor, paired with powerful weapons like the Terra Blade, Tactical Shotgun, or Piranha Gun, are highly recommended.

  • Build an Arena: A well-designed arena can significantly improve your survivability. Include multiple layers of platforms for maneuverability, campfires and heart lanterns for health regeneration, and sunflowers for movement speed.

  • Potions: Stock up on essential potions like Healing Potions, Regeneration Potions, Ironskin Potions, Swiftness Potions, and Lifeforce Potions.

  • Minions and Sentries: Summon as many minions and sentries as possible. They can provide valuable extra damage and help clear out hordes of enemies. The Terraprisma or Stardust Dragon Staff are excellent minion choices.

  • Know the Enemy: Familiarize yourself with the attack patterns of the Pumpkin Moon enemies, including the Headless Horseman. This knowledge will help you anticipate their attacks and dodge effectively.

The Headless Horseman: Combat Strategies

The Headless Horseman is a fast and aggressive enemy. Here are some tips for taking him down:

  • Mobility is Key: The Headless Horseman moves quickly, so you’ll need to be agile. Use wings or a hook to stay mobile and dodge his attacks.

  • High DPS Weapons: Focus on weapons that deal high damage per second. The Headless Horseman has a decent amount of health, so you’ll want to bring him down quickly.

  • Penetrating Attacks: Weapons that can pierce through multiple enemies are effective against the hordes of enemies that spawn during the Pumpkin Moon.

  • Stay Aware: Pay attention to your surroundings and avoid getting cornered. The Headless Horseman can quickly overwhelm you if you’re not careful.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about the Headless Horseman

Here are some FAQs about the Headless Horseman, providing additional valuable information.

1. Is the Headless Horseman a boss?

No, the Headless Horseman is not a boss. He is considered a mini-boss or a powerful enemy that spawns during the Pumpkin Moon event. The Pumpkin Moon has a main boss, Pumpking.

2. What are the drops from the Headless Horseman?

The Headless Horseman drops the Jack ‘O Lantern Launcher, a powerful ranged weapon that fires exploding Jack ‘O Lanterns, and the Horseman’s Hood, a vanity item.

3. How rare is the Jack ‘O Lantern Launcher drop?

The drop rate for the Jack ‘O Lantern Launcher varies but is generally around 12.5%.

4. Can I summon the Pumpkin Moon in pre-Hardmode?

No, the Pumpkin Moon is a Hardmode event and requires defeating Plantera to trigger.

6. What happens if I die during the Pumpkin Moon?

If you die during the Pumpkin Moon, you will respawn at your spawn point. The event will continue until dawn (4:30 AM) or until you leave the world.

7. Can other players join my Pumpkin Moon event?

Yes, the Pumpkin Moon is a multiplayer event. Other players can join your world and participate in the event with you.

8. What is the highest wave I can reach in the Pumpkin Moon?

There is no limit to the number of waves you can reach in the Pumpkin Moon. However, reaching higher waves becomes increasingly difficult.

9. Are there any other ways to increase the spawn rate of the Headless Horseman?

The spawn rate of the Headless Horseman is primarily determined by the wave number in the Pumpkin Moon. Reaching higher waves will increase his spawn rate. Using Battle Potions and Water Candles can increase the overall spawn rate of enemies, but this will affect all enemies, not just the Headless Horseman.

15. Is the Horseman’s Blade dropped by the Headless Horseman?

No, the Horseman’s Blade is dropped by Pumpking, the final boss of the Pumpkin Moon event, not the Headless Horseman. This is a common misconception due to the similar names.
